UnitedHealthcare COVID-19 billing guide
UnitedHealthcare will cover medically appropriate COVID-19 testing at no cost share during the national public health emergency period (currently scheduled to end Oct. 17, 2021) when ordered by a physician or appropriately licensed health care professional for purposes of the diagnosis or treatment of an individual member.
